Iosco draws systemic risk roadmap for securities regulators

International Organisation of Securities Commissions sets out ways in which securities authorities can help control systemic risk

iosco

The International Organisation of Securities Commissions (Iosco), an international group of securities and futures regulators, on Friday outlined ways in which securities regulators could quash the build-up of systemic risk.
